Using technology to meet client needs

Apr 19 2007 by David Wheeler in Articles, Member news

Bill Essert, owner of Wooden Window in Oakland, CA, has been restoring and manufacturing high-end custom windows for almost 30 years. But now he has a new woodworking machine that’s allowing him to better meet the needs of his clients, increase his company’s productivity and, as a result, add a nice spark to his company’s revenues.

For example, a recent project presented some significant security concerns - the house has a safe room and requires visitors to enter through security checkpoints, and its owners needed 8 doors refurbished. Previously, this job would have required three days to complete with a 2-man crew, but with Bill’s new ‘worker’ the job was finished in a single day. And the house was secure before 3 pm. I’m sure these security-conscious clients appreciated the quick and unobtrusive work made possible by Wooden Window’s innovative practices.
